#5656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5656ef is composed of 33.7% red, 33.7%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64% cyan, 64%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 63.7%. #5656ef color hex could be obtained by blending #acacff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#5656ef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5656ef has RGB values of R:86, G:86,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 5658351.

Shades and Tints of #5656ef
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010a is the darkest color, while #f7f7fe is the lightest one.
